Research and Policy Manager
Posted 3 hours 3 minutes ago by The Right Ethos - Specialist External Affairs Recruitment
The role is 4 days a week, salary will be pro rata £40,174 for 0.8 FTE
This role will help Ageing Better deliver its ambition for more people to live in Age-friendly Homes and Communities-enabling people to live well, age well, and remain independent for as long as possible.
Reporting to the Head of Homes, asResearch and Policy Manager (Homes and Communities), you will design and deliver research and policy projects from end to end by setting priorities, applying robust methodologies, managing partnerships and ensuring outputs are accessible, impactful and evidence-based. Working closely with colleagues across the Homes and Communities Team to ensure projects help to influence national and local policy and support our wider goals.
As one of two research and policy managers, you will be taking a lead delivery role on our research projects and be responsible for designing and conducting original research using both quantitative and qualitative methods, generating new insights that inform our policy positions and contribute to meaningful change.
You will also model our commitment to tackling inequalities and ensuring that the voice of a diverse mix of people in later life is visible and influential within all our activities.
About you
We are looking for someone with strong experience in delivering research projects, including defining research questions, selecting appropriate methodologies and producing clear, high-quality outputs while managing budgets and risks. You will be confident using qualitative and quantitative research methods, including evaluation approaches and have experience turning detailed findings into practical and actionable insights. Experience in basic data analysis is essential.
You will be highly organised with the ability to manage multiple priorities, deadlines and stakeholders effectively and bring strong project management skills. You will also be a clear and effective communicator. This includes being able to produce engaging outputs such as reports, blogs and case studies, alongside being confident designing and facilitating workshops. We are looking for someone who builds positive working relationships, works collaboratively and can contribute effectively both independently and as part of a team.
